Common Obstacles in Airway Management and Exactly How to Conquer Them Via Training

Managing an individual's air passage is fraught with obstacles that can impact their security and recovery. Below are some prevalent issues:

Anatomical Variability
    Different clients present one-of-a-kind physiological frameworks. As an example, weight problems, age, or hereditary abnormalities can complicate intubation. Solution: Educating programs like standard ventilator programs provide hands-on practice with diverse anatomical models to mimic real-life scenarios.
Equipment Familiarity
    Many health care professionals may not be familiar with the most up to date ventilation tools or techniques. Solution: Regular presence at updated ventilation training courses ensures professionals remain efficient in using modern-day devices.
Acute Respiratory system Distress
    Conditions like bronchial asthma or COPD can make standard air flow strategies much less effective. Solution: Advanced ventilation training instructs different techniques such as high-flow nasal cannulae and non-invasive positive pressure ventilation.
Psychological Barriers
    Anxiety during high-pressure circumstances can hinder performance. Solution: Simulation-based training assists develop confidence with repetitive method under worry-free conditions.
Team Communication
    Effective airway administration frequently entails several staff member; bad communication can lead to errors. Solution: Interprofessional training sessions foster far better team effort and make clear functions during emergency situations.
Legal Implications
    Improper airway administration can lead to lawful consequences for health care providers. Solution: Education on methods and standards throughout training reduces dangers related to respiratory tract management.

Understanding Airway Administration Techniques

What is Air passage Management?

Airway administration describes the techniques utilized to make certain the patency of the airway between the setting and an individual's lungs. This includes stopping blockage, guaranteeing sufficient ventilation, and supplying appropriate oxygenation.

Importance of Proper Air flow Techniques

Proper ventilation strategies are vital for maintaining oxygen levels in critically sick individuals. Not enough air flow can lead to hypoxia, which has major effects consisting of body organ failure or death.

Ventilator Training for Nurses

Overview of Ventilator Use

Ventilators supply mechanical support for people who can not take a breath separately due to clinical problems such as respiratory system failure or neuromuscular disorders.

Importance of Specialized Ventilator Training

Nurses need to undertake specialized ventilator training to understand:

    Settings like tidal quantity and stress support Monitoring ventilator alarms Recognizing indications of ventilator-induced lung injury

FAQs Concerning Respiratory tract Monitoring Challenges

FAQ 1: What Ought to I Do If I Run Into Problem Intubating a Patient?

If you experience trouble intubating a client, take into consideration calling for aid from colleagues experienced in challenging air passages. Use adjuncts such as video laryngoscopes if offered, which can provide better visualization than direct laryngoscopy alone.

FAQ 2: Exactly how Can I Boost My Team's Interaction During Air passage Emergencies?

Conduct regular simulation drills concentrating on emergency situation scenarios that need clear communication among employee. Establishing standard interaction methods can substantially improve synergy under pressure.

FAQ 3: What Are Some Signs That A Client Requirements Immediate Ventilator Support?

Signs that a patient may need instant ventilator assistance include severe respiratory distress (e.g., tachypnea), transformed mental standing because of hypoxia, or evidence of breathing muscle exhaustion (e.g., accessory muscle mass use).

FAQ 4: Is There a Conventional Method for Taking Care Of Individuals with Tracheostomies?

Yes! Acquaint yourself with institutional protocols pertaining to tracheostomy care, consisting of suctioning treatments, cuff inflation/deflation practices, and emergency interventions when confronted with accidental decannulation.
